linux常用的kill命令整理

这篇文章主要介绍“linux常用的kill命令整理”,在日常操作中,相信很多人在linux常用的kill命令整理问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”linux常用的kill命令整理”的疑惑有所帮助!接下来,请跟着小编一起来学习吧!

这篇文章主要介绍“linux常用的kill命令整理”,在日常操作中,相信很多人在linux常用的kill命令整理问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”linux常用的kill命令整理”的疑惑有所帮助!接下来,请跟着小编一起来学习吧!

创新互联是专业的宿松网站建设公司,宿松接单;提供成都网站设计、成都网站制作、外贸网站建设,网页设计,网站设计,建网站,PHP网站建设等专业做网站服务;采用PHP框架,可快速的进行宿松网站开发网页制作和功能扩展;专业做搜索引擎喜爱的网站,专业的做网站团队,希望更多企业前来合作!

当我们执行一个"kill"命令,实际上是发送了一个信号给系统,让它去终结不正常的应用。目前 kill 命令总共有 60 个你可以使用的信号,但是基本上我们只需要知道 SIGTERM(15) 和 SIGKILL(9)。这两个是最常用的,其他常用的命令列表如下:

1 HUP: hangup

2 INIT: 相当于 Ctrl + c

9 KILL

15 TERM: Terminate (kill 的默认信号)

18 CONT: Continue (从STOP信号中恢复)

19 STOP: Stop

我们可以使用 kill -l 命令,列出整个 kill 信号的列表。

SIGTERM – 此信号请求一个进程停止运行。此信号是可以被忽略的。进程可以用一段时间来正常关闭,一个程序的正常关闭一般需要一段时间来保存进度并释放资源。换句话说,它不是强制停止。

SIGKILL – 此信号强制进程立刻停止运行。程序不能忽略此信号,而未保存的进度将会丢失。

使用 kill 的语法是:

默认信号(当没有指定的时候)是 SIGTERM。当它不起作用时,你可以使用下面的命令来强制 kill 掉一个进程:

最常用的命令是 kill -9,用法如下:

这里 -9 代表着 SIGKILL 信号。也就是前面那个信号列表中每个命令和信号前面的编号。

如果不知道应用的 PID,仅需要运行这个命令:

我们常用的是 ps ux|grep java。kill 命令还有几个兄弟命令,比如 PKill、Killall、xkill 等。

当前文章:linux常用的kill命令整理
文章出自:https://www.cdcxhl.com/article34/edodpe.html

成都网站建设公司_创新互联,为您提供外贸网站建设软件开发面包屑导航微信小程序响应式网站手机网站建设

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联

手机网站建设